Air Conditioning Repair

Cooling systems tend to reveal problems gradually. You may first notice that the home feels a bit warmer than normal even though the temperature setting remains the same. The system keeps running, but the cooling never quite catches up with the heat outside. In other cases, the system may start producing strange sounds or shutting off unexpectedly during the peak heat hours. Cooling units contain several areas where trouble can develop like the external condenser unit, the internal evaporator coil, wiring and electrical components, refrigerant flow, and airflow through the duct network. With Harold HVAC Services in Paloma Creek, Texas, our team examine each of these sections carefully during a repair visit. By analyzing how the system removes heat from the house, they can determine where the cooling cycle is breaking down. Once the fault is resolved, the unit can go back to normal operation of cooling the house gradually without operating longer than it should.

HVAC System Installation

Every heating and cooling unit reaches a stage where fixing it repeatedly is no longer worthwhile. The unit can still operate, but issues start happening more often and efficiency begins to decline. Upgrading the unit gives homeowners the opportunity to install equipment that matches the needs of the house more closely. Before recommending a replacement system, Harold HVAC Services in Paloma Creek, Texas reviews the structure of the house. Home size, insulation, air circulation, and the design of the ductwork all influence how a heating and cooling system should be selected. Choosing equipment that fits these conditions prevents the system from overworking itself or turning on and off too often. Once installation begins, each component of the system is carefully set up so that the equipment operates smoothly within the homes structure.

Ductwork Inspection and Repair

The duct system moves conditioned air throughout the building, yet it often is concealed within walls and structural spaces. Because it is out of sight, problems can form without being detected right away. Small leaks along the ducts may allow cooled or heated air to escape before reaching the intended rooms. Dust buildup or small obstructions can also limit proper airflow. Whenever Harold HVAC Services in Paloma Creek, Texas evaluates ductwork, the goal is to determine airflow patterns. Areas where airflow weakens or escapes are repaired so the system can distribute air evenly again. Enhanced airflow often improves overall system performance.

Paloma Creek is a master-planned community in northeastern Denton County, Texas, United States. The community is listed by the U.S. Census Bureau as two separate census-designated places, "Paloma Creek" and "Paloma Creek South", separated by U.S. Highway 380. As of the 2010 census, the Paloma Creek CDP (known locally as "Paloma Creek North") had a population of 2,501, while Paloma Creek South had a population of 2,753. As of 2022, the HOA currently estimates the population to be approximately 20,000.
